North Port Performing Arts Center
For those who love the arts, the North Port Performing Arts Center is a must-visit. This state-of-the-art facility features a 1,000-seat auditorium that hosts a variety of performances ranging from Broadway shows to classical music concerts. The center also has a black box theater, which showcases smaller productions and experimental works. If you are lucky, you might catch a performance from one of the local talent groups, such as the North Port Chorale or the North Port Symphony.
Venice Myakka River Park
Nature lovers will find plenty to explore in the Venice Myakka River Park. This 57-acre park is located on the banks of the Myakka River and offers a variety of outdoor activities. You can take a leisurely stroll on the nature trails that wind through the mangroves or rent a kayak and paddle down the river. The park is also home to a variety of wildlife, including alligators, bald eagles, and ospreys. Big Cat Habitat and Gulf Coast Sanctuary
Animal lovers will appreciate the Big Cat Habitat and Gulf Coast Sanctuary, a non-profit organization that provides a home for exotic animals that have been rescued from abusive environments. Visitors can take a guided tour of the facility and see tigers, lions, bears, and other animals up close. You can also attend one of the daily animal shows, where you can learn about the animals and their behaviors. The sanctuary also offers a petting zoo, where you can interact with domestic animals such as goats and sheep.
